The Heart of the System: Variable Speed Pumps
The pump is the most critical component of your filtration system, circulating water to ensure chemicals are distributed and debris is removed. Modern in-ground pool equipment reviews consistently highlight the transition from single-speed models to variable-speed pumps as the single best investment for cost savings. These units allow you to adjust the flow rate based on specific needs, such as running a low-speed cycle for daily filtration and a high-speed cycle for vacuuming.
Top Performance Metrics for Pumps
- Energy Efficiency: Look for ENERGY STAR certified models that can reduce energy consumption by up to 90% compared to traditional pumps.
- Noise Levels: Premium models often feature totally enclosed fan-cooled (TEFC) motors which operate much more quietly than standard motors.
- Automation Compatibility: Ensure the pump can communicate with your existing pool controller for seamless operation.

Filtration Excellence: Sand, Cartridge, and DE
Choosing the right filter is essential for water clarity and ease of maintenance. In-ground pool equipment reviews often categorize filters into three main types: sand, cartridge, and Diatomaceous Earth (DE). Each has unique advantages depending on your local environment and how much time you want to spend on upkeep.
Sand Filters
Sand filters are favored for their simplicity and low upfront cost. They work by pushing water through a bed of specialized pool sand, which traps particles down to 20-40 microns. While they require regular backwashing, they are incredibly durable and easy to operate.
Cartridge Filters
Many modern in-ground pool equipment reviews recommend cartridge filters for those looking to conserve water. These systems do not require backwashing; instead, you simply remove the pleated cartridges and rinse them with a garden hose. They provide superior filtration compared to sand, catching particles as small as 10-15 microns.
DE Filters
For the ultimate in water clarity, DE filters are the gold standard. They use a fine powder made from crushed fossils to coat internal grids, filtering out particles as small as 1-5 microns. While they require more intensive maintenance, the resulting water quality is often described as “polished” or “diamond-like.”
Heating Solutions for Extended Seasons
To get the most out of your investment, a reliable heater is a must-have. In-ground pool equipment reviews typically compare gas heaters and electric heat pumps. Gas heaters are excellent for rapid heating and performing well in any weather, making them ideal for spas or sporadically used pools.
Conversely, heat pumps are highly efficient for maintaining a consistent temperature over long periods. They work by extracting heat from the ambient air and transferring it to the water. While they have a higher initial cost, their low monthly operating expenses make them a favorite in warmer climates where the pool is used daily.
Sanitization and Automation Upgrades
Beyond the basics, in-ground pool equipment reviews often delve into salt chlorine generators and automation systems. Salt systems have gained massive popularity because they create a softer water feel and eliminate the need to handle liquid or tablet chlorine. By converting salt into pure chlorine through electrolysis, these systems provide a steady, automated sanitization flow.
The Rise of Smart Pool Technology
Automation is the final piece of the puzzle for a modern backyard. Smart controllers allow you to manage your pump speeds, lighting, heating, and water features directly from a smartphone app. Reviews suggest that while these systems require a professional setup, the convenience of adjusting your pool temperature while driving home from work is invaluable.
Choosing the Right Equipment for Your Needs
When evaluating in-ground pool equipment reviews, it is important to consider your specific geographic location and pool size. A pump that is too powerful for your piping can cause damage, while an undersized filter will lead to cloudy water and frequent cleanings. Always consult the manufacturer’s sizing charts to ensure your components are perfectly matched to your pool’s gallonage.
